Yes, thank you. We're aiming for titanium, if able. I appreciate the heads-up. We have digitization and water jet available, so are leaning in that direction. We'll most likely finalize all the holes with a lexan prototype then digitize all that and cut out a finished product.
 
Atlee Dodge sells a PA-12 titanium firewall for $1,000.

From their website: "Our Titanium Firewalls are built to order using your old firewall as a template for correct opening locations. A flange is formed around the edges to stiffen the firewall and allow for easier boot cowl fabrication."
 
Thanks. AD used to sell complete firewall / boot cowl, but no longer. They told me there were too many issues with boot cowl fit-up.
 
Many thanks for the guys here who sent me tracings. Now I have a dxf drawing from measuring coordinates off of those tracings. I'd be happy to share it with anyone who needs it. Steve Furjesi will water-jet cut a prototype from Lexan, then the finished part frpm titanium after all the penetrations are finalized and digitized.
 
Gordon, I found it helpful to mount the engine without the firewall. Then I got a better picture of just where the holes ought to be. Sometimes it became apparent that the hole should be "here" instead of just a little bit over "there". The push/pull controls need a relaxing gentle curve for best operation. Sometimes it became apparent the curve in the control should be behind the firewall instead of in front making the hole several inches away from where I had thought it ought to be. If the hole in the firewall is just a little bit wrong, you can create a resistance/wear location.
